1 Scope
This document specifies requirements for non-modified flat poly(methyl methacrylate) (PMMA)
continuous cast sheets for general-purpose use. The sheets can be colourless or coloured, and can be
transparent, translucent or opaque.The thickness range of the sheets covered by document is 1 mm to 10 mm.
